Born and raised in Sydney, attended Barker College, studied at Billy Blue School of Graphic Design and Advertising and fast-tracked his degree by being accepted into the Masters Program in Digital Media at Sydney University. He was accepted into Cambridge University 2019-2020 and specialised in Digital Disruption. Received a scholarship in 2018 for 'Leadership and Management' and 'Business'. Author of How Apps are Changing the World with contributors from Disney and Saatchi & Saatchi New York.

The chosen candidate to run in the 2019 NSW State Election for the Lower House Seat of Davidson. He was again chosen to run for the Seat of Bradfield in the 2019 Australian Federal Election. He was nominated on his Leadership ability and his work for the community of Ku-ring-gai, Davidson and around Sydney. He is also a member of the Rural Fire Service NSW. In 2019 he judged the AC&E Awards for Best use of Mobile Marketing, judged the B&T Awards 2019, judged the App Promotion Summit 2019 in Berlin Germany, judged the 7NEWS Young Achiever Awards NSW/ACT 2019/2020. Nominated for Australian of the Year 2020 and was featured on the cover of Coaching Life Magazine.
